Transaction 50ff3e3606f7ede08a83e51221101384ea20ca405394558a7017544bc57c30f2
1 Input
1 Output
-
50ff3e3606f7ede08a83e51221101384ea20ca405394558a7017544bc57c30f2:0
- value
- 15293
- script pubkey
- OP_0 OP_PUSHBYTES_20 5df03a8b8b693ed261a9c4ed316e0373ba70afac
- address
- bc1qthcr4zutdyldycdfcnknzmsrwwa8ptavgwa0cr